An air raid alert was issued in Romania due to a Russian attack
On the afternoon of July 23, an air raid alert was issued in the Romanian county of Tulcea, which borders Ukraine, due to a Russian attack on the Odesa region.
Residents of settlements along the Danube received the warning.
Through the RO-Alert system, people were urged to immediately proceed to shelters, basements, or take cover behind two walls. The estimated duration of the threat was 90 minutes.
During Russian strikes on Ukrainian Danube ports, Romania regularly issues air raid alerts in border areas. Debris from Russian drones has been found on Romanian territory on multiple previous occasions.
